Are you suffering from a toothache? Hopefully not, but if you are, children at Patriot Elementary school in Papillion would be the first to say you are suffering from a compound word.

The first-graders had fun learning about how a compound word is any word made up of two or more smaller words, like tooth and ache.

They used goldfish, a compound word, in math to practice counting and in art class they drew pictures of a rainbow. “They came up with some words that are unbelievable, as you can see with little Megan here,” said teacher Kim Lynam. “She had a great time planning her outfit for the day."

“I have a sweatshirt, sweatpants, headband, bow, wristwatch and a Band-Aid and a necklace,” said Megan Sianez.
